python--变量和常量

变量

变量的类型由赋值的类型决定!这与C,JAVA很不同!!
  • 变量赋值
  • 语句结束
  • 命名规则**

1、 赋值的方法

## 变量生成 ##
    num = 100   ## 单个赋值
    a = b = c = 100  ###多变量赋值
    a, b, c = 100, 90, 80 ###对应不同变量赋值

## 变量回收##
    num = 100   ## 单个赋值
    del num     ## 回收变量的内存,该变量就不存在了
也可以同时删除多个变量
    del a, b  ##同时删除a,b 

2、 语句的结束

    在python中,严格的语句对齐,一行一般只有一条语句
    语句的结束,一般不加分号,但是一行存在多条语句时,可以用分号结束--
    **但是不推荐,一行存在多条语句**

3、 命名的规则

    命名规则与Java、C语言相同
    以字母,数字,下划线组成,并且数字不能开头!
    命名的习惯时:遵循驼峰原则,第一个单词的字母小写,其余单词首字符大写

4、 标识符

    python中的标识付区分大小写
    不能使用python中的关键字!

常量

在python中,是不存在不可变的变量的!!也不存在所谓的常量!!
在C语言中用:   #define PI 3.1415f...  
在Java中 :  public static final String XXXX= "xx"

so,在python编程总,大家约定俗成,若某个变量,我不想让其他人或地方改变,就把这个变量名字命名成全部大写,虽然这个变量可以被改变!!

你可能感兴趣的:(Python)